Example Evaluation

To further illustrate how these principles apply, let’s hypothetically evaluate a statement:

  • Statement: “The main function of the male testis is to produce estrogen.”
    • Evaluation: This statement is incorrect. The primary function of the male testes is to produce sperm (spermatogenesis) and testosterone, the principal male sex hormone. While small amounts of estrogen can be produced by the testes, it is not their main function.
